Question: Is age gap common in Japan?

In Japan, its 1.4 years (pdf). Thats a pattern seen around the world: Age gaps show up among heterosexual couples in every culture. Some evolutionary explanations have been proposed (older men may have more resources, younger women may be more fertile), but none are easily testable.

What age do Japanese men marry?

Mean age of marriage Japan 1955-2019, by gender In 2019, it was estimated that the average age of women who marry for the first time was 29.6 years, while men were on average 31.2 years old when they first got married.
